Out of school C.H.S. Students and Youth Groups While some C.H.S. stu- dents spent their out of school time partying and play- ing, others spent their time in youth groups, working to bet- ter the community. Volleyball, talent contests, and group vacations are just a few of the activities Charles- town Youth Groups sponsored and shared. l6 Reverend Roy Bennett, Pas- tor of First Assembly of God and regular substitute at CHS explained that youth groups often serve as positive influ- ences for both yOung peeple and the community. Youth groups, said Ben- nett, may not benefit the school and community visual- ly, but they help by giving them positive moral effects. But it isn't all fun and games; Members also have to donate a portion of their time to Chris- tian studies. People join youth grows for various reasons, according to Bennett. Some join to feel like they belong, others because its an extension of their church life. Girls! Girls! Girls!
